Luxury Care Home in Sheringham Officially Opens Its Doors

West Wood Care Home, a newly built, state-of-the-art facility in Sheringham, has officially opened its doors and welcomed its first residents.

The newly built 70-bed care home is the latest addition to Avery Healthcare’s portfolio.

Located in a prime location in Sheringham overlooking the golf course, West Wood Care Home offers exceptional residential, respite, and dementia care services in a luxurious and comfortable environment for older adults.

The home features premium amenities, including a hair salon, cinema, café, outdoor terraces, companion rooms, private dining options, and beautifully landscaped gardens. These facilities are designed to provide comfort, convenience, and an enriched quality of life for all residents.

The home’s first resident, Ann Stamp, moved in last Monday at the age of 83, marking the start of a thriving and welcoming community for seniors.
